No reduction from LGs Allocation to Fund KWASU and others Ongoing Projects
The KWASU engineering complex was not financed by deduction from allocation accruing to local councils, but solely from the state government purse. The Finance of the State and the monthly allocation are being made transparent and open to the public for consumptions contrary to what the critics and wailers are saying, the State Government don't hide anything the Finance of the State.
The monthly allocation of the State and local councils within the state are made open to the public.
